The Card Network Alliance That Reveals the Real AI Payment War

The same two card networks that have spent twenty years battling over interchange fees just agreed on something. Visa and Mastercard, alongside Ant International, are jointly building a cross-network identity standard for AI agents called KYA—Know Your Agent. The announcement is buried in industry newsletters, accompanied by vague press statements about "interoperability" and "frictionless commerce." The data shows something else entirely: this is a defensive coalition formed out of mutual fear, not opportunity. Context: What is KYA and Why Now? KYA is a proposed verification layer that answers two questions about an AI agent: who is it, and who does it represent? The idea is simple—once an agent is verified in one network (say VisaNet), it can initiate payments across Mastercard or Alipay+ without repeated registration. The three parties are building a federated trust framework, akin to W3C Verifiable Credentials or FIDO, but applied to the specific problem of autonomous payment authorization. The timing is no accident. By late 2025, the first wave of agentic commerce—AI assistants booking flights, negotiating subscriptions, and executing B2B procurement—is hitting the fringes of mainstream adoption. Google launched AP2 (Agent Payment Protocol). OpenAI partnered with Stripe on ACP (Agent Commerce Protocol). These are not experimental sandboxes; they are live experiments in how machines pay for services. And they all bypass the traditional card networks’ authorization flow. The card networks see their centuries-old role—trust intermediary—being replaced by a stack where the agent’s identity is managed by the platform that hosts it. Core: The Architecture of a Defensive Play Let me be precise about what this coalition reveals. It is not a product. It is a standards body in embryonic form, competing with at least two other developing standards. The technical architecture is federated: each network retains its own identity registry, but they agree on a shared protocol for exchanging trust assertions. This mirrors the architecture of early decentralized identity projects like Sovrin or the more pragmatic OAuth 2.0 token exchange pattern. KYA faces a similar risk: if a single network’s verification method is compromised—say, a malicious agent forges its identity credentials on Ant’s side—the mutual recognition clause instantly propagates that fraud across Visa and Mastercard networks. The code does not lie, but it does leave traces. The trace here is a single point of trust propagation. The real technical debate is unstated in the press releases: who holds the root of trust? Is it a shared ledger? A multi-party computation that requires a quorum of all three? Or a simple bilateral memorandum that each party stores independently? The latter is the most likely for speed, but it is the least resilient. If the three parties cannot agree on a shared root-of-trust model, they will default to bilateral agreements—effectively replicating the problem they claim to solve. But the deeper story is not technical; it is economic. The business model behind KYA is classic “infrastructure land grab”: zero direct revenue, all upside depends on total transaction volume flowing through agent-initiated payments. The three networks are placing a bet that the share of payments automated by agents will grow from near-zero to double-digit percentages within three to five years. They are paying upfront to own the identity middleware layer, because they fear being reduced to a dumb settlement rail—a commodity pipe that loses pricing power and consumer relationships. Contrarian: The Alliance That May Not Survive Its Own Success The conventional take is that this is a smart, preemptive move by established players to define a standard before Big Tech does. I disagree. This alliance has three critical blind spots that will likely kill it or render it irrelevant. First, the cold start problem. KYA has zero value until enough agent developers and merchants integrate it. The three parties control large merchant networks, but those merchants are not yet deploying AI agents at scale. Without a critical mass of agents on the other side, the identity layer remains an empty shell. Visa and Mastercard have tried before to launch new payment protocols—look at the adoption curve of 3-D Secure 2.0, which took nearly a decade to reach meaningful penetration. Agent commerce moves faster. By the time KYA gains traction, platforms like OpenAI or Google will have already defined de facto standards through sheer developer adoption. Second, the responsibility vacuum. KYA verifies identity, but it does not verify the legitimacy of the instruction. If an agent unauthorized by its principal makes a payment, who bears the loss? The networks will push the liability to the merchant; the merchant will push it to the platform that hosted the agent; the platform has no contract with the payment networks. The result is a wave of chargeback disputes that undermine the entire premise of trustless automation. Yield is a symptom, not the cure. The yield here is the transaction volume—but the hidden cost is the fraud liability that no one has modeled yet. Third, the alliance’s fragility. Visa and Mastercard are direct competitors in every other business line. Ant International is a Chinese entity that faces geopolitical headwinds in both the US and EU markets. The moment any one of them believes they can capture more value by going solo—say, by acquiring a startup that builds a more elegant identity protocol—the coalition dissolves. Governance is the art of managing disagreement. This agreement has no governance mechanism other than a press release. When disagreements surface over technical standards or revenue sharing, there is no arbitration layer. I have seen similar alliances (the Enterprise Ethereum Alliance, the blockchain consortia from 2018) that died precisely because the incentives to cooperate never matched the incentives to defect. Takeaway: The Real Battleground Is Not the Standard—It Is the Developer Ecosystem The question investors and builders should be asking is not whether KYA is technically sound, but whether it can integrate into the workflows of the developers who are building the next generation of AI commerce agents. The card networks are not competing against each other; they are competing against an alternative paradigm where trust is managed by the agent’s hosting platform through cryptographic signatures and on-chain attestations. But that requires a long-term vision that runs counter to quarterly earnings. I am not optimistic. The most likely outcome is that KYA becomes a regional standard—adopted in markets where card networks remain dominant and where Big Tech is less entrenched (Southeast Asia through Ant, parts of Europe through Mastercard). But in the US and China, the platforms will develop their own identity layers, and the cross-network vision will be reduced to a handful of bilateral integrations. In the red, we find the structural truth. The red here is the 0.5% of fraudulent agent transactions that will eventually surface, causing a regulatory backlash that forces every player to retreat into walled gardens. The irony is that the card networks’ biggest advantage—their established compliance infrastructure—will become their biggest liability, because regulators will hold them accountable for every agent transaction they clear. The coalition does not yet understand that they are not building a moat; they are building a target. And in the new world of agent commerce, the safest path may be to not own the identity layer at all.
